When Megastar Sharon Cuneta launched her stellar comeback bid last year, she had her choice of former leading men to pick for her screen consort.

At first, fans favored Aga Muhlach, but he was still in the process of getting back to fighting and shooting trim.

For our part, we figured that a Sharon-Gabby Concepcion costarrer would be making the biggest waves at the box office, given their tumultuous reel-and-real relationship. But, the problem was Sharon’s heft at the time—which observers feared would be further exacerbated by Gabby’s trimmer projection.

In any case, Sharon and her mentors finally decided that Robin Padilla would be “it”—and it turned out to be a great choice, because their comeback film, “Unexpectedly Yours,” did blockbuster business at the box office.

But, one big hit deserves another, so fans are clamoring for a new Sharon movie in 2018. Will the Sharon-Gabby “dream” team-up finally see the light of film?

No news yet on that score—but, most winningly, the estranged duo recently costarred together again—not in a film or a TV production, but in a new commercial for a big fast-food treat!

Since Sharon has shed even more weight, the feared visual mismatch with Gabby has been averted, so the nostalgic spot rings all intended bells.
